Mole National Park Ghana – Everything you need to know

  1. Fly to Tamale
    • You can do a day trip from Accra – fly into Tamale at 6 am on Passion Air or Africa World Airlines (it’s an hour’s flight) for $70 return then drive 3 hours to Mole in the Savvanah Region. Once you get to the park, do a 2-hour nature safari to see Elephants and Antelopes and have some breakfast before flying back to Accra on the 5 pm flight.
    • Spend a night or more in Tamale and fully enjoy Mole. This option allows you to do a longer Safari.
  2. Drive 12+ hours from Accra to Mole (this isn’t advisable because of safety).

If you’re on a budget but still want to experience a Safari, Mole is where you need to go. Compared to East & Southern African Safaris this is very pocket-friendly.

  1. Zaina Lodge: this is West Africa’s first luxury safari lodge located inside Mole Mole National Park. Staying here is an experience in itself with opportunities to have close encounters with the Elephants.
  2. Mole Motel: this is Mole National Park’s very own lodge. Staying here makes it easy to see all the animals at your convenience.
